Q. The speed of light in media $M_{1}$ and $M_{2}$ are $1.5 \times 10^{8} m / s$ and $2.0 \times 10^{8} m / s$ respectively. A ray of light enters from medium $M_{1}$ to $M_{2}$ at an incidence angle $\theta$. If the ray suffers total internal reflection, Then the value of the angle of incidence $\theta$ is

Solution:

Refractive index for medium $M_{1}$ is
$\mu_{1}=\frac{c}{v_{1}}=\frac{3 \times 10^{8}}{1.5 \times 10^{8}}=\frac{3}{2}$
For total internal reflection
$\sin i \geq \sin C$
where $i=$ angle of incidence
$C =$ critical angle
But $\sin C=\frac{\mu_{2}}{\mu_{1}}$
$\sin i \geq \frac{\mu_{2}}{\mu_{1}} \geq \frac{3 / 2}{2} $
$\Rightarrow i \geq \sin ^{-1}\left(\frac{3}{4}\right)$
